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02341 97421511206 71944 1976933395
8829 6352 0380
8829 6352 0380
6884110309 3932897 06825 020319 3907
All about undefined
Interested in learning more?
8829 6352 0380
6884110309 3932897 06825 020319 3907
See more
83354465841 3039309250
6983393 2572 8960
See more
455 71472 3655678
65231117146 61912 1932
See more